Taking Action: Steps to Expedite Your Insurance Claim

justice

If your motorcycle accident insurance claim is taking longer than expected, don’t wait passively. There are several proactive steps you can take to expedite the process and ensure a faster resolution. First, gather all necessary documentation related to the accident, including medical bills, police reports, and witness statements. Organize these documents clearly and provide them directly to your insurance company to streamline the review process.

Next, communicate directly with your insurer’s claims adjuster. Politely inquire about the status of your claim and any delays encountered. Request a specific timeframe for resolution, ensuring they commit to a reasonable deadline. What To Do If the Insurance Company Denies Your Claim

justice

If your motorcycle accident insurance claim is denied by the insurance company, it’s crucial to understand your rights and take immediate action. The first step is to thoroughly review the reasons provided for the denial. Insurance companies often deny claims due to various reasons, such as misrepresented information, failure to file within the required timeframe, or questions about the severity of the injuries. If you believe there was a misunderstanding or error, gather all necessary documents, including medical records, police reports, and any evidence that supports your claim.
